Bac Ninh: National campaign launched to promote foreign language learning

The Ministry of Education and Training (MoET) held a ceremony in Bac Ninh Province on December 30 to launch a national campaign to promote foreign language learning and encourage self-study initiatives on improving language proficiency within educational institutions.

Speaking at the launch, Deputy Minister Pham Ngoc Thuong emphasised that the teaching and learning of foreign languages is a significant focus for the education sector.

He stated that proficiency in foreign languages not only facilitates cultural exchange but also enhances individual competitiveness, thus contributing to the sustainable development of the country.

While applauding the effective teaching methods and results in English language education in Bac Ninh Province, the deputy minister expressed his hope that Bac Ninh would lead in piloting effective models and practices in the nationwide English teaching movement.

Looking ahead, to gradually establish English as a second language in schools, Deputy Minister Pham Ngoc Thuong urged localities across the country to pay attention to foreign language instruction; and enhance communication efforts aimed at raising societal awareness, especially among the youth, regarding the importance of foreign language education within the national education system.

This campaign is part of MoET’s broader efforts to implement the Politburo’s directive, which urges the education sector to prioritise enhancing students’ and learners’ foreign language skills, with the ultimate aim of establishing English as a second language in schools.
